Research Abstract

To realize a novel mode liquid crystal(LC) devices, we have performed the development of fabrication processes of the photo-alignment layers that can generate a desired pretilt angle of LC molecules between 0°and 90°. By fabricating photo-alignment layers consisting of micrometer-size homogeneous and homeotropic alignment domains, we confirmed that the pretilt angle can be controlled by the domain area ratio. This result suggests the usefulness of the nano-domain patterned photo-alignment layers for controlling the pretilt angle. We proposed another fabrication method using amine vapor treatment, and succeeded in significantly extending the controllable range of the pretilt angle.
